Output fd763f64397e0143d175944c39187f5220959be53dfca458d3bc1b51ec53d182:0

value
15430837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373de37e94bb63a41908cba9f10369e167359 OP_EQUAL
address
3BMEX515RgXti7vadaJ4gDdPKMcTWvWhNZ
transaction
fd763f64397e0143d175944c39187f5220959be53dfca458d3bc1b51ec53d182
confirmations
314089
spent
true